The AI Startup Gold Rush

Remember the California Gold Rush? Well, we're witnessing something similar in the AI world. Startups are scrambling to stake their claim in this new territory, and the buzz is palpable.


Yang Zhilin, the founder of Moonshot AI (and probably the coolest 31-year-old you'll ever meet), called o1 "hugely significant." It's like he just saw the AI equivalent of sliced bread and can't wait to make a sandwich.


Yang believes o1 could shake things up across various industries and create new opportunities for startups. It's as if OpenAI just handed out a bunch of shovels and said, "There's gold in them thar hills!"



The Secret Sauce: Reinforcement Learning

Now, here's where it gets really interesting. OpenAI has been training these new models to think more like humans. They're not just spitting out pre-programmed responses; they're taking time to ponder problems, try different strategies, and even recognize their own mistakes. It's like they're giving AI a crash course in "How to Human 101."


This approach, called reinforcement learning, is like teaching a dog new tricks, but instead of a dog, it's a super-intelligent computer, and instead of "sit" and "stay," it's "solve quantum physics" and "write a Shakespearean sonnet."



The Great Computing Power Conundrum

Of course, with great AI comes great need for computing power. It's like trying to run the latest video game on your grandma's old desktop - it's just not going to cut it.


This is where things get a bit sticky for Chinese startups. Due to US trade sanctions, they can't get their hands on the fancy chips made by companies like Nvidia. It's like being invited to a potluck but not being allowed to bring the good stuff.
